Anjum Fakih on leaving conservative parents for showbiz: I put away my burqa, packed my bags and left

Anjum Fakih, who is now known as Srishty of Kundali Bhagya, has not had an easy journey in showbiz. From someone who had never watched TV till she was a teenager, to becoming a television actress herself, she has come a long way. Anjum, who belongs to a traditional Muslim family from Ratnagiri, ruffled a lot of feathers when she decided to take up modelling as a career. (Photo: Instagram)

Watching TV was a taboo

The actress told TOI, "My family was quite strict and conservative, and even watching TV was taboo in our house. Finally, when I was in Class 9, my father bought a television set after much persuasion. In fact, my grandfather did not visit us for two years because we had a TV at home!" (Photo: Instagram)

3/8

Was asked to leave home

While they were conservative about certain things, Anjum’s parents were very particular about giving their children good education. "My father wanted us to be well educated. So, in 2009, when I told them about my decision to quit studies and pursue modelling, they were very upset. It was almost like there was an earthquake in my house, and they said that I would have to leave home if I wanted to enter showbiz. I put away my burqa, packed my bags and left home," she said. Struggler in Mumbai

Life wasn't rosy in Mumbai. Anjum recalled, "I started working as a sales executive in stores, selling perfumes. Those days, I used to walk from Bandra to Andheri to give auditions. I did not have money, but never called my parents for support. There used to be a food joint on Carter Road and the uncle there would feed me veg pulao every day, free of cost." (Photo: Instagram)

Bikini assignment made family boycott her

After a few months of struggle, Anjum finally landed a modelling assignment. She shared, "It was an assignment in Goa, which required me to wear a bikini. When I informed my family about it, all hell broke loose. For one year, they did not keep in touch with me." (Photo: Instagram)

Parents are now happy to see her in salwar kameez on TV

Today, however, the situation is different. Anjum, who is currently seen in 'Kundali Bhagya', said, "Slowly, my parents began to understand my career, and they are happy to watch me on screen now. They are probably happy to see me in a salwar kameez on TV now (laughs!). It’s all so good now, that my mother even stays with me." (Photo: Instagram)

TV shows

Anjum has done several popular shows on TV including Ek Tha Raja Ek Thi Rani, Devanshi and Tere Sheher Mein. (Photo: Instagram)
